Italy, Bruttium, Kroton, (c.520 B.C.), silver nomos, stater or didrachm (7.91 g), obv. Delphic tripod with three handles and legs terminating in lion's feet and set on exergual line of dots between plain lines, cable and pellet border, **QPO to left, rev. Delphic tripod incuse in flan, (S.225, Weber 997, SNG ANS 230, SNG Manchester 306, SNG Cop. 1735, Gale 1, BMC 3). Toned, well centred, good very fine and rare.

Ex Brian Bolton Collection and previously Antiquarius New Zealand, 2016, with ticket.
